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1368221 9980601509 3161578717 439
993 08743677
993 08743677
3180 6602328700 68
All about undefined
Interested in learning more?
993 08743677
3180 6602328700 68
See more
73255985039 144
75868 90 050
See more
9122825939 06186878896 14488766
5794524 486946 90814
See more